Mamdani, AOC, Omar among far lefties piling on Trump over Iran strikes

New York City’s Mayor, Zohran Mamdani, along with Representatives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ez and Ilhan Omar, spearheaded a group of progressive politicians denouncing President Trump’s decision to carry out airstrikes in conjunction with Israel against Iran.

“The military actions against Iran today—executed by the US and Israel—represent a disastrous escalation of what is already an unlawful war of aggression,” Mamdani stated on Saturday. This proclamation came just a few days after the socialist mayor found common ground with Trump regarding potential housing investments in New York City during a recent visit to the White House.

“Bombing urban areas. Causing civilian casualties. Initiating another war zone. This is not what Americans desire. They are not in favor of another war aimed at regime change. They seek solutions to the affordability crisis. They long for peace,” Mamdani emphasized.

The mayor reiterated his commitment to ensuring the safety of all New Yorkers. He has been in communication with Police Commissioner Jessica Tisch and emergency management teams to implement “proactive measures, such as boosting coordination among agencies and enhancing patrols at sensitive sites, out of an abundance of caution,” he explained in a statement.

“Moreover, I want to directly address Iranian New Yorkers: you are integral to the fabric of this city—you are our neighbors, small business owners, students, artists, workers, and community leaders,” said Mamdani, who was born in Uganda. “You will be safe here.”

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ez slammed the strikes as “unlawful.” ZUMAPRESS.com

Ocasio Cortez (D-NY) also accused Trump of “dragging” Americans “into a war they did not want,” alleging the president “does not care about the long-term consequences of his actions.

“This war is unlawful. It is unnecessary. And it will be catastrophic,” she ranted.

 Omar (D-Minnesota) also piled on the president, accusing Trump of “unilaterally dragging this nation into an illegal and unjustified war with Iran without congressional authorization, without a clear objective, and without any imminent threat to the United States.”
